High-order harmonic generation from plasma mirrors

Abstract
We discuss the two mechanisms involved in high-order harmonic generation from plasma mirrors, and show that they can be clearly identified experimentally. The very different phase properties of the corresponding harmonics lead to light beams with different divergences. This can be exploited to select a particular type of harmonic by spatial filtering in the far-field.
